Page 1 sur 1
pb ftsearch

Publié:
26 Juin 2003 à 14:55
par aer
Je voudrais faire un FTsearch avec une requete multiple. J' ai essayé ça mais ça ne marche pas

famille provient d'un getitemvalue)requete$ = famille & " ident_famille"Set collection = db.FTSearch( requete ,1)
Re: pb ftsearch

Publié:
26 Juin 2003 à 15:00
par Stephane Maillard
Bonjour,Quel est la syntaxe complète de la requète ?[%sig%]
Re: pb ftsearch

Publié:
26 Juin 2003 à 15:05
par aer
Eh bien c' est ce que j' ai donné. Je veux trouver le document qui contient un champ caché calculé qui vaut "ident_fam" et qui contient dans un autre champ une valeur que je récupere du formulaire. Le probleme c'est que ma requete est concaténée et donc ne marche pas.
Re: pb ftsearch

Publié:
26 Juin 2003 à 15:09
par Stephane Maillard
Re,Normalement c'est le nom du champs égal à la valeur recherchée, donc ident_fam="MaValeur" ou "ident_fam=" & Chr$(34) & "MaValeur" & Chr$(34).Le Chr$(34) correspond au guillemet "[%sig%]
Re: pb ftsearch

Publié:
26 Juin 2003 à 15:16
par Droad
Essaye ça:requete$ = famille & " AND ident_famille"ou ça:requete$ = |"| & famille & |" AND "ident_famille"|Tu devrais également tester tes requêtes directement dans le module de recherche du client pour t'assurer de leur validité.
Re: pb ftsearch

Publié:
26 Juin 2003 à 15:20
par aer
re,Je me suis mal expliqué, en fait je veux trouver un document qui correspond à :champs1= valeur1 et champs2 = valeur2et je ne trouve pas la syntaxe.
Re: pb ftsearch

Publié:
26 Juin 2003 à 15:24
par Stephane Maillard
Re,FIELD champs1=valeur1 AND FIELD champs2=valeur2[%sig%]
Re: pb ftsearch

Publié:
26 Juin 2003 à 15:26
par Droad
Ya plein de possibilités:[champs1] = valeur1 AND [champs2] = valeur2FIELD champs1 = valeur1 & FIELD champs2 = valeur2FIELD champs1 CONTAINS valeur1 AND FIELD champs2 CONTAINS valeur2[champs1] = "valeur1" AND [champs2] = "valeur2"La syntaxe du FTSearch est bien détaillée dans l'aide Designer (rechercher "refine a search")